Rate-splitting multiple-access allows one to use single-user coding/decoding techniques to achieve any rate tuple that lies inside the capacity region of an asynchronous multiple-access channel. We introduce rate-splitting multiple-access for the 2-user Gaussian multiple-access channel and then consider a general 2-user discrete memoryless multiple-access channel. Both cases generalize to M-users.
